How to Use
Your medication should not be shared with others, and the prescribed dose should not be exceeded. You can take Zovirax with or without food. Zovirax ointment should not be used in or near th
e eyes. To reduce the risk of spreading the infection, use a rubber glove to apply the ointment. Zovirax cream should not be used in or near the eyes, or inside the nose or mouth. The medica
tion can, however, be applied on the outside of the lips. Apply the cream with your fingers to clean, dry skin. Be sure to wash your hands before and after applying Zovirax cream, and avoid bathing or
swimming afterward to prevent it from washing off. Do not cover the cold sore with a bandage or make-up unless your doctor approves.

Description
Zovirax is used to treat herpes infections of the skin, lip, and genitals; herpes zoster (shingles); and chickenpox. It does not cure herpes infections but decreases pain and itching and promotes heal
ing. Topical Zovirax does not prevent the recurrence of sores but may decrease pain and itching if applied when the earliest symptoms first appear. Oral Zovirax decreases the frequency and se
verity of recurrent sores, but it is used only by people with severe herpes infections because of possible adverse effects.

Significant Interactions:
Other nephrotoxic agents and probenecid. Reports of 30% decrease clearance of Zovirax when used with probenecid; reduced Zovirax dose

Cautions
If your symptoms do not improve within a few days, or if they become worse, check with your doctor. The areas affected by herpes, chickenpox, or shingles should be kept as clean and dry as po
ssible. Also, wear loose-fitting clothing to avoid irritating the sores (blisters). It is important to remember that Zovirax will not keep you from spreading herpes to others.
